Dozens of residents were welcomed into their new homes at a special completion event at Farmstead Road in Bellingham, marking the successful delivery of this housing project by Buxton.

David Norman, Managing Director of Buxton, stated: "Buxton are proud to have delivered the project for Phoenix Community Housing, providing high-quality, sustainable homes for their residents, whilst also supporting wider community social value criteria during the course of the development."
The Farmstead Road development, designed by Metropolitan Workshop, features 18 affordable rental homes and six shared ownership properties built to the Passivhaus standard. This ensures energy efficiency, helping residents reduce energy costs while addressing environmental challenges like fuel poverty and climate change.

Denise Fowler, Chief Executive of Phoenix Community Housing, celebrated the milestone, saying: "It was fantastic to welcome residents into their new homes and to celebrate the completion of this beautifully designed scheme. Having a high-quality home makes such a difference to people’s lives, and we’re already seeing a lovely community forming here."
